Patients who are driven back home after surgery are asked to stop every 1 to 2 hours to get out and walk around for a 5 to 10 minutes. When patients fly to NC for their tubal reversal surgery, they are fine to plan a departure flight home for anytime after 12 noon the day after their tubal reversal surgery.
